Understanding Prime Day Pricing

During Prime Day, many products are discounted significantly, but not all deals are equally good. Retailers often mark up prices before the event to make discounts appear more substantial. Therefore, it’s essential to compare Prime Day prices with the regular retail prices to assess the actual savings.

How to Compare Prices Effectively

  • Research Regular Prices: Check the product’s typical price on multiple trusted websites or previous sales data.
  • Use Price Tracking Tools: Websites and browser extensions like CamelCamelCamel or Honey can show historical price data.
  • Compare Across Retailers: Sometimes, other stores may offer the same product at a lower regular price.
  • Beware of Inflated Prices: Look out for artificially inflated prices before discounts are applied.

Examples of Prime Day Deals vs Regular Prices

Below are some typical examples that illustrate the importance of price comparison:

Electronics

A popular smartphone might be discounted from a regular price of $799 to $699 during Prime Day. However, if the regular price was inflated or if the phone often goes on sale for around $650, the Prime Day discount may not be as significant as it appears.

Home Appliances

A blender regularly priced at $120 might be offered at $90 during Prime Day. Checking other stores reveals that the same model is usually sold at around $85, indicating the Prime Day deal is only marginally better.
